Our Beliefs

It is essential that we never lose sight of the fact that our faith is not simply a list of statements about us or our Church. Our faith is relationship — relationship with Jesus Christ. This provides a basis for relationship with each other. This should always be the foundation of our understanding of Moravian identity. Once we understand this, then we can use the statements below as a way to describe this relationship.

  • Moravians believe in one God: Father, Son and Holy Spirit

  • Moravians believe that Jesus Christ is the way to God and God’s way to us.

  • Moravians believe that a personal, heart-felt relationship with God through Jesus Christ is an essential part of faith.

  • Moravians hold that faith in Jesus Christ must also be a community experience.

  • Moravians believe the Church is called into existence by Jesus Christ to serve him and follow him.

  • Moravians find guidance for doctrine and faith through the Bible.

  • Moravians subscribe to the major creeds of the Church, including the Apostles’ and the Nicene creeds.

  • Moravians share God’s love in word and deed with people of other cultures and in all the world.

  • Moravians have a heritage of creativity in our music and worship.

  • Moravians believe that discerning God’s will is a task to be shared among many leaders rather than to be vested in a single person or office. Thus, there is a conferential form of government which shares this responsibility.

  • Moravians place great value on their ties with Christians of other Moravian provinces and with Christians of other denominations throughout the world.

From the Interprovincial Faith & Order Commission of the Moravian Church in North America.
